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add native support for workers #48

Merged
merged 1 commit into from Jan 7, 2020
Merged

Add native support for workers #48

merged 1 commit into from Jan 7, 2020

Conversation

@pyrech
Copy link
Member

pyrech commented Jan 7, 2020

This PR add native support for worker on the Docker infrastructure. Workers are stopped before running dependencies installation, database updates. They are started only when everything else is ready.

ATM Fabric tasks and Docker services show examples to use with symfony/messenger.

@pyrech pyrech requested a review from lyrixx Jan 7, 2020
@pyrech pyrech force-pushed the workers branch from b62cb03 to f668752 Jan 7, 2020
@lyrixx
lyrixx approved these changes Jan 7, 2020
infrastructure/docker/docker-compose.worker.yml Outdated Show resolved Hide resolved
@ternel
ternel approved these changes Jan 7, 2020
@pyrech pyrech force-pushed the workers branch from f668752 to 50db093 Jan 7, 2020
@pyrech pyrech force-pushed the workers branch from 7db1f64 to 4f271e6 Jan 7, 2020
@pyrech pyrech merged commit ff4e2ff into master Jan 7, 2020
2 checks passed
2 checks passed
ci/circleci: check-python-cs Your tests passed on CircleCI!
Details
ci/circleci: tests Your tests passed on CircleCI!
Details
@pyrech pyrech deleted the workers branch Jan 7, 2020
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
3 participants
You can’t perform that action at this time.